@charset "UTF-8";#Top #TopContent .slider{width:100%}#Top #TopContent .slider img{width:100%;height:auto}#Top #TopContent .top_text{font-size:18px;text-align:center;padding:30px 0;letter-spacing:1px}#Top #TopContent .list_box{padding-bottom:20px}#Top #TopContent .list_box ul li{float:left;margin-right:23px;position:relative}#Top #TopContent .list_box .text_box{position:absolute;bottom:0;background-color:#4a96d1;width:311px;padding:20px 0 15px;font-size:15px;color:#fff;opacity:.9;line-height:20px;letter-spacing:1px}#Top #TopContent .list_box .text_box img{padding-right:5px;padding-left:15px}#Top #MainTop{float:left;width:645px;margin-right:20px}#Top #SideTop{float:right;background-color:#f6f6f6;padding:0 0 20px;width:315px}#Top #SideTop .facebook{border-left:solid 1px #ccc;border-right:solid 1px #ccc;border-bottom:solid 1px #ccc;box-sizing:border-box;margin-bottom:25px}#Top #SideTop .facebook .title{background:#3c5a97 !important;width:95.1%;padding:11px 0 6px 5%;letter-spacing:2px}#Top #SideTop .contact{border-left:solid 1px #ccc;border-right:solid 1px #ccc;border-bottom:solid 1px #ccc;box-sizing:border-box;font-size:15px}#Top #SideTop .contact .title{background:#c03b22 !important;width:95.1%;padding:11px 0 6px 5%;letter-spacing:2px}#Top #SideTop .contact .title img{position:relative;top:6px}#Top #SideTop .contact .content_box{background-color:#fff;padding:20px 10px 0}#Top #SideTop .contact .content_box div{padding-bottom:20px}#Top #SideTop .contact .content_box .red{text-align:center;color:#c03b22;padding-bottom:20px}#Top #SideTop .contact .address,#Top #SideTop .contact .tel{letter-spacing:1px}#Top #SideTop .contact .address .subtitle,#Top #SideTop .contact .tel .subtitle{line-height:21px;margin-bottom:5px}#Top #SideTop .contact .address .subtitle img,#Top #SideTop .contact .tel .subtitle img{margin-right:5px}#Top #MainTop .news .news_category ul li{float:left;width:85px;text-align:center;padding:5px 0 3px;margin-right:4px;border-radius:5px;font-size:13px}#Top #MainTop .news .news_category ul li a{color:#fff}#Top #MainTop .news .news_content{padding:20px 10px 0;border-left:solid 1px #ccc;border-right:solid 1px #ccc;border-bottom:solid 1px #ccc;box-sizing:border-box;background:#fff}#Top #MainTop .news .lightblue{background-color:#4396d6;border-bottom:solid 3px #2e74ab}#Top #MainTop .news .red{background-color:#c03b22;border-bottom:solid 3px #8a2815}#Top #MainTop .news .yellow{background-color:#f39d00;border-bottom:solid 3px #b07a19}#Top #MainTop .news .green{background-color:#1aa063;border-bottom:solid 3px #127d4c}#Top #MainTop .news .blue{background-color:#206ca3;border-bottom:solid 2px #13507c}#Top #MainTop .news .purple{background-color:#7533af;border-bottom:solid 2px #571591}#Top #MainTop .news .gray{background-color:#949494;border-bottom:solid 2px #666}#Top #MainTop .news .article ul li{padding:20px 0 15px;border-bottom:dotted 1px #ccc}#Top #MainTop .news .article ul li:last-child{border-bottom:none}#Top #MainTop .news .article .top{font-size:12px}#Top #MainTop .news .article .top .date{float:left;margin-right:10px}#Top #MainTop .news .article .top .cotegory{float:left;padding:2px 10px;background-color:#c03b22;border-radius:3px}#Top #MainTop .news .article .top .cotegory a{color:#fff}#Top #MainTop .news .article #news #Main .article .top .cotegory a{color:#fff}#Top #MainTop .news .article .recruitment{float:left;padding:2px 10px;background-color:#c03b22;border-radius:3px;color:#fff;width:50px;text-align:center;margin-right:5px}#Top #MainTop .news .article .info{float:left;padding:2px 10px;background-color:#f39d00;border-radius:3px;color:#fff;width:50px;margin-right:5px;text-align:center}#Top #MainTop .news .article .sports{float:left;padding:2px 10px;background-color:#1aa063;border-radius:3px;color:#fff;width:75px;margin-right:5px;text-align:center}#Top #MainTop .news .article .event{float:left;padding:2px 10px;background-color:#206ca3;border-radius:3px;color:#fff;width:50px;margin-right:5px;text-align:center}#Top #MainTop .news .article .report{float:left;padding:2px 10px;background-color:#7533af;border-radius:3px;color:#fff;width:50px;margin-right:5px;text-align:center}#Top #MainTop .news .article .other{float:left;padding:2px 10px;background-color:#949494;border-radius:3px;color:#fff;width:50px;margin-right:5px;text-align:center}#Top #MainTop .news .article .news_title{margin-top:5px;font-size:16px}#Top #MainTop .news .article .news_title a{text-decoration:underline}#Top #UnderContent ul li{width:311px;height:91px;float:left;font-size:17.5px;margin-top:25px;margin-right:23px;position:relative;color:#c03b22;letter-spacing:1px}#Top #UnderContent ul li.li01{background:url(//sainokuni-sasa.or.jp/wp-content/themes/sainokuni_theme/css/../img/under_menu_bg01.png) no-repeat 100% 100%}#Top #UnderContent ul li.li01 p{position:absolute;top:33px;left:120px}#Top #UnderContent ul li.li02{background:url(//sainokuni-sasa.or.jp/wp-content/themes/sainokuni_theme/css/../img/under_menu_bg02.png) no-repeat 100% 100%}#Top #UnderContent ul li.li02 p{position:absolute;top:33px;left:100px}#Top #UnderContent ul li.li03{background:url(//sainokuni-sasa.or.jp/wp-content/themes/sainokuni_theme/css/../img/under_menu_bg03.png) no-repeat 100% 100%}#Top #UnderContent ul li.li03 p{position:absolute;top:33px;left:80px}#Top .banner ul{text-align:center;margin-top:20px}#Top .banner ul li{display:inline;margin-right:15px}